Villers-Saint-Frambourg, a region in the Oise department of Hauts-de-France, offers diverse landscapes for outdoor pursuits. The area is characterized by the extensive Halatte Forest, one of France's largest natural old-growth forests, and Mont Pagnotte, the highest point in the Oise department. These features provide varied terrain suitable for several sports like touring cycling, jogging, hiking, road cycling, and more.

The primary natural attractions are the Halatte Forest and Mont Pagnotte. Halatte Forest is one of France's largest natural old-growth forests, covering 43 square kilometers. Mont Pagnotte is the highest point in the Oise department, reaching 722 feet (220 meters).

The region provides routes for touring cycling, road cycling, mountain biking, and gravel biking. Touring cyclists can use easy-to-cycle narrow roads, while road cyclists can tackle the paved ascents of Mont Pagnotte. Guides for each cycling type are available on komoot.
Mont Pagnotte offers paved roads with an average gradient of 3.6% over 3.2 miles (5.1 km) and a total ascent of 604 feet (184 meters). This provides a pleasant climb in a quiet area with minimal traffic. It is a popular spot for road cyclists.
The region offers routes suitable for various skill levels, including easy options. For example, a 'Mont Pagnotte viewpoint – Mont Pagnotte loop' is described as easy and suitable for all skill levels. Many forest paths are also suitable for leisurely family outings.
Halatte Forest offers a range of trail difficulties. Options include leisurely forest walks and more extensive hikes. A 'grand tour of the Halatte State Forest' is a more difficult option, spanning 13.4 miles (21.62 km) with 686 feet (209 meters) of ascent.
